#842833 - Shiraz color
Deep, dusky berry-red that leans toward rich maroon with a whisper of plum. It feels warm and velvety, like aged wine or crushed raspberries in shadow. Sophisticated and moody, it adds intimate, luxurious character to interiors or branding without becoming overpowering. Pairs beautifully with warm neutrals like cream and camel, metallic gold for elegance, or deep navy and charcoal for contrast. Use it for accents, upholstery, or packaging when you want an inviting yet dramatic effect.
